Airtable
Airtable is a flexible cloud-based platform that combines the simplicity of a spreadsheet with the power of a robust database to help teams build custom workflows and connected applications.
DataStax Astra DB
DataStax Astra DB is a managed cloud database service built on Apache Cassandra that provides a scalable, serverless platform for building and deploying high-performance real-time applications and AI solutions.

Overview
Airtable
Airtable gives you the freedom to organize your work exactly how you want by combining a flexible database with a familiar spreadsheet interface. You can track anything from inventory and marketing campaigns to product roadmaps and applicant tracking systems. Instead of being forced into a rigid structure, you build custom applications that perfectly match your team's specific requirements and data needs.
You can visualize your information through multiple lenses, including grid, kanban, calendar, and gallery views. The platform allows you to automate repetitive tasks and integrate with your existing tech stack to keep your data synced. Whether you are a solo creator or part of a global enterprise, you can create a single source of truth that evolves alongside your growing business operations.
DataStax Astra DB
DataStax Astra DB provides you with a fully managed, serverless database built on the power of Apache Cassandra. You can deploy global applications instantly without the headache of managing complex infrastructure or scaling nodes manually. It handles the heavy lifting of database administration, including patches, updates, and security, so you can focus entirely on writing code and delivering features to your users.
Whether you are building a small prototype or a massive AI-driven application, the platform scales automatically to meet your traffic demands. You can store and search high-dimensional vectors for generative AI projects or manage traditional structured data with high availability. With its pay-as-you-go model, you only pay for the resources you actually consume, making it a cost-effective choice for modern developers and enterprise teams alike.

DataStax Astra DB Features
- Serverless Architecture. Deploy your database instantly and let the system handle scaling and maintenance automatically while you only pay for what you use.
- Vector Search. Build and power generative AI applications by storing and searching high-dimensional embeddings with high performance and low latency.
- Multi-Region Deployment. Place your data closer to your users globally across AWS, Azure, and Google Cloud to ensure lightning-fast response times.
- Data API (JSON). Interact with your data using a simple JSON API, allowing you to build applications faster without learning complex query languages.
- Integrated Streaming. Connect your real-time data pipelines effortlessly to your database to power live dashboards and reactive application features.
- Enterprise Security. Protect your sensitive information with built-in encryption, private networking options, and role-based access control for your entire team.
